What advice would you give someone starting this project?
Take your time choosing fabrics for this block, it is a good way to learn about tone on tone prints and co-ordinating colour.
I used a black shirt of my husbands, which he had never worn (actually not even out of the wrapper), for the back of the cushion... saves having to make buttonholes and sew buttons on :)
I think this block pattern is more suited to a quilt than a cushion, as it looses some of the pattern when filled with the cushion filler or maybe just make a larger cushion, mine was 16.5".
